Rumor has it that Mack Brown tried to get Chase Daniel to switch his committment from Missouri to Texas at the last minute. Apparently Daniel (qb from the state champs Southlake Carroll) wanted to go to UT all his life, but since Mack had Perrilloux, Daniel committed to Missouri. Daniel turned down Mack's request and signed with Missouri today. It looks like UT's only quarterback this class will be Colt McCoy, the quarterback from Jim Ned high school, which is a 2A school.
